Malabar Whistling Thrush


One of the iconic bird species found in Chikmagalur is the Malabar Whistling Thrush. This beautiful bird, with its glossy blue-black plumage and melodious calls, can be spotted near streams and waterfalls. Listen to its enchanting whistles as you immerse yourself in the serene ambiance of Chikmagalur’s forests.

Indian Pitta


The Indian Pitta is a colorful migratory bird that visits Chikmagalur during the summer months. Its vibrant plumage, adorned with shades of green, blue, and orange, makes it a sight to behold. Listen to its distinctive calls and catch glimpses of its lively movements as it forages for insects on the forest floor.

Nilgiri Wood Pigeon


Chikmagalur is home to the majestic Nilgiri Wood Pigeon, a large bird with a stunning plumage of gray and maroon. Spot this beauty perched high in the trees, feasting on fruits and seeds. The Nilgiri Wood Pigeon’s presence adds an aura of elegance to the forests of Chikmagalur.

Malabar Trogon


The Malabar Trogon is a true gem of Chikmagalur’s avifauna. With its vibrant plumage of deep green and red, this elusive bird is a delight to encounter. Keep your eyes peeled for its distinctive calls and watch as it glides gracefully through the forest canopy.

Indian Peafowl


The resplendent Indian Peafowl, with its iridescent plumage and mesmerizing display of feathers, can be spotted in Chikmagalur’s open grasslands and agricultural fields. Marvel at the grandeur of the male peafowl as it proudly displays its magnificent tail feathers, creating a visual spectacle.

Other Bird Species


Chikmagalur is home to a diverse range of bird species, offering a treasure trove of sightings. Look out for the Malabar Pied Hornbill, a majestic bird with a large, curved beak and striking black and white plumage. Spot the White-bellied Blue Flycatcher flitting from branch to branch, showcasing its beautiful blue coloration. And keep an eye out for the stunning Crested Goshawk soaring through the skies, displaying its prowess as a raptor.
